We got married at Boehmer in the fall. I have to say it was a great experience from beginning to end. We had about 100 guests, plus vendors (including a five piece live band), so I was concerned about space. They assured me it would work, and they were right. We chose to do the ceremony at the front of the restaurant as the sun was setting. The photos came out beautifully, the lighting was really soft and natural. About 1/3 of our guests were seated, with the rest standing behind the chairs. The staff was very respectful during the ceremony to keep their dinner prep noise to a minimum. In fact the staff was flat-out amazing throughout the entire event! Friendly and efficient, very impressive. Most of the operation is headed by Gordon, the manager, and Alanna, the event coordinator that the venue supplies. Full disclosure, Alanna was awesome, but has moved on to other things. However I'm sure whoever they've replaced her with is awesome as well. Responsive to emails and as concerned about details as we were! Gordon is a machine on the night... several of my guests went out of their way to rave about him to me. It was kind of funny actually, they were truly blown away. The guests also raved about the food, as they should. It was top notch. In terms of logistics, they allowed us to bring our decorations and other items in ahead of time, and allowed us to pick up our items a day or two after the wedding. They worked to accomodate our needs. They have the logistics down cold. The guests walk in and enjoy a signature cocktail or two that are being passed around. The bar doesn't open until after the ceremony. Chairs for the ceremony are already set up. There is a small private area at the back of the restaurant where the wedding party can make a home base, and walk up and down the aisle from. The ceremony happens, and then everyone moves towards the back of the restaurant while the staff puts dining tables where the ceremony was. At the back of the restaurant is an oyster bar. Bar is open and the band is playing a jazz set. Eventually everyone sits for dinner / speeches and as I mentioned, the food is amazing. Dietary restrictions are accommodated. We chose to have the vendors enjoy their meals in the "alcove" that juts out behind the head table, and they seemed perfectly happy back there. As soon as the dinner and the speeches are finished, the staff quickly removes the tables they added at the front, and that space becomes the dance floor. The front patio doors are opened up to their patio on the street so guests can enjoy some fresh air. And late at night, a table appears with some late night snacks to help soak up the booze. Additionally there is a lengthy tasting of the food and booze in advance, so you can finalize your menu. Gordon is incredibly knowledgeable in his wine selection. This is an enjoyable experience. And to top it off, they give you a complimentary dinner months after the fact as a thank you. My wife and I just recently enjoyed our meal and were reminded of how great the staff and the venue turned out to be for our wedding. I'd recommend Boehmer as a great option for anyone looking for a downtown wedding with top-notch ambiance, food, and staff.
